Losing Weight and Keeping it Off - Eating Powerfoods to Keep Your Body Healthy During Weight Loss

If you are just beginning a weight loss diet, you may be wondering which foods to eat and which you should avoid. While we all know that ice cream and potato chips are not foods we should eat, it is unclear about which foods we need to be eating.

Maintaining a balanced diet is always important, and if you are going to decrease your caloric intake and increase your exercise in order to lose weight, it is more important than ever. There are several foods that are considered to be superfoods, and many people who are dieticians or nutritionists agree that they should be included in your diet on a regular basis, even if you are not trying to lose any weight. These are the foods that are so important in your daily diet:

* Blueberries, or any type of berries if you can't get blueberries easily. Fresh is best, but frozen will do if they are out of season or just too expensive
* Salmon - cold water fish, wild instead of farm raised - will have all of the omega oils you need for optimum health
* Almonds and other raw nuts - a great source of protein and other nutrients
* Broccoli - this vegetable has many vitamins, minerals, and nutrients that can be beneficial to your immune system
